Lakehills is a census-designated place (CDP) in Bandera County, Texas, United States. The population was 5,150 at the 2010 census, making it the most populous place in Bandera county. It is part of the San Antonio Metropolitan Statistical Area.

History

Lakehills was originally known as Upper Medina Lake, until a post office substation was established in the area in the early 1960s. Two toll roads served the area until the late 1940s–early 1950s.

Geography

Lakehills is located 12 miles (19 km) southeast of Bandera and 30 miles (48 km) west of Downtown San Antonio. The town is on Medina Lake.

According to the United States Census Bureau, the CDP has a total area of 34.4 square miles (89 km), of which, 30.3 square miles (78 km) of it is land and 4.1 square miles (11 km) of it (11.87%) is water.
